Summer Saaz is one of the newer Australian varieties. Sometimes it is assumed it is a Saaz copy that will provide the same qualities as the Czech Saaz. This is a misunderstanding. Yes it does have some of the same qualities but it is a different hop with different flavours. It provides a nice smooth bitterness if you choose to use it that way, but with its low Alpha I wouldn't. There are better bittering hops out there. The flavour is similar to the Czech Saaz but it is different. There is more fruit and less spice in the taste. I really enjoy it. For those that love Saaz this would be a good hop to try something a little different. It will provide a hint of spice like the Czech Saaz but add a different dimension with some fruit flavours coming through. The flavour is quite subtle, as is the aroma. I think it would work well as a blend with Saaz in any Czech Pils.
